TechRadar Investigative Report on Big Tech Censorship

TechRadar published an investigative report detailing how Big Tech companies like Google and Apple have cooperated with authoritarian regimes in censoring online content, emphasizing issues of transparency and accountability.

  • TechRadar Advocates for Remote Work Flexibility Logo
    NOV
    25
    2024

    An article published on November 25, 2024, by TechRadar argues that tech companies should embrace remote work policies instead of mandating full-time office returns. The piece highlights research showing enhanced productivity, better work-life balance, and improved talent attraction when flexible working options are offered, thereby supporting progressive labor practices.
